Brief Summary
|
i am going to compare and correlate the already existing method of assessing SVR (systemic vascular resistance) which is snuffbox resistivity index and the novel approach that is transpalmar resistivity index. No previous study has been done on transpalmar resistivity index. Transpalmar resistivity index is easier to measure and probe placement is also easier and better and it is also less time consuming. I will enroll the patients as per my inclusion criteria and if the study and both parameters correlates well, then we can conduct further study on critically ill patients. |
